3. Route Options
The availability of multiple travel paths between Austin and San Antonio influences the actual distance traversed and the overall travel experience. Choice of route directly impacts not only the mileage covered but also factors such as driving time, fuel consumption, and exposure to traffic congestion.
-
Interstate 35 (I-35)
I-35 represents the most direct and commonly utilized route. Its relative straightness contributes to a shorter mileage figure compared to alternative options. However, reliance on I-35 exposes travelers to potentially heavy traffic, particularly during peak hours, which can significantly extend the time required to traverse the distance. The interstate also facilitates access to numerous intermediate towns and services along the corridor.
-
US Highway 281
This highway provides a more scenic, albeit less direct, alternative. It generally features lower traffic volume than I-35, which can result in a more relaxed driving experience. However, the increased mileage associated with US 281 typically translates to a longer overall travel time and increased fuel consumption. The highway also passes through smaller towns and rural areas, offering different opportunities for rest stops and exploration.

4. Traffic Impact
Traffic congestion significantly influences the perception and experience of distance between Austin and San Antonio. While the physical separation remains constant, the impact of traffic directly affects travel time, turning a relatively short geographical distance into a potentially lengthy and arduous journey. Increased traffic volume, particularly during peak hours, effectively expands the temporal distance, altering the practicality and efficiency of travel between the two cities.
The primary cause of traffic impact is the high volume of vehicles traversing Interstate 35, the most direct route. Commuting patterns, freight transport, and tourism contribute to this consistent congestion. For example, a trip that might typically take approximately 1.5 hours under ideal conditions can easily extend to 2.5 or 3 hours during rush hour, substantially increasing the perceived distance. Real-time traffic data and navigation systems are frequently used to mitigate these effects, allowing drivers to adjust their routes or departure times in an attempt to circumvent the worst congestion. Construction projects further compound the problem, creating bottlenecks and unpredictable delays. Frequently Asked Questions
This section addresses common inquiries regarding the geographical separation and travel considerations between Austin and San Antonio. The following questions and answers provide concise and factual information to assist in planning journeys between the two cities.
Question 1: What is the approximate driving distance between the city centers?
The distance is generally around 80 miles (129 kilometers) via Interstate 35. However, this figure may vary depending on the specific points of origin and destination within each city.
Question 2: How long does it typically take to drive?
Under optimal conditions, the drive can be completed in approximately 1 hour and 15 minutes to 1 hour and 30 minutes. Traffic congestion can substantially increase this duration, especially during peak commuting hours.
Question 3: Are there alternative routes besides Interstate 35?
Yes, US Highway 281 provides an alternative, though it is generally longer in terms of mileage and travel time. This route may offer less traffic congestion and more scenic views.
Question 4: What factors can significantly impact travel time?
Traffic congestion, road construction, accidents, and adverse weather conditions are the primary factors that can prolong travel time. Real-time traffic updates are recommended for mitigating potential delays.
Question 5: Are there public transportation options available?
Commercial bus services provide transportation between Austin and San Antonio. Direct commuter rail service is not currently available, although it has been a topic of discussion.
Question 6: How much will fuel cost for a round trip?
Fuel costs depend on the vehicle’s fuel efficiency and current fuel prices. Calculating the round-trip mileage and applying the vehicle’s MPG rating will provide an estimate. Checking local fuel prices is essential for accurate budgeting.
